BJP on Friday accused Darul Uloom of “communalising” nationalism after the Islamic seminary asked Muslims to refrain from raising ‘Bharat mata ki jai’ slogan while its ally Shiv Sena termed it as a “new terrorism”.

BJP said moderate and liberal Muslims take pride in raising nationalist slogans like this but hardliners with medieval beliefs raise such issues for their own sectarian interests. “There is a clear attempt by some sections to communalise nationalism. There is a large section of moderate Muslims, including likes of Javed Akhtar and A R Rahman, and liberal Muslims who take pride in raising nationalist slogans.
